I watched the game with my son (current Iowa student) and my daughter (an Iowa grad) and actually said something very similar. It was a fascinating game to me as the two teams had very different styles, and when that happens, the team that forces the other team to play their style will usually win. For much of the first half, Iowa was able to force OSU to play Iowa's style, and we saw that OSU didn't transition back on defense very well, and Iowa kept OSU from getting the ball to the high post frequently. That all changed in the latter part of the second half where OSU dictated play getting more Iowa turnovers and on O consistently getting the ball in the paint.
